Investment Analysis Report: Constellation Brands Inc. (STZ)

Overview:

Constellation Brands Inc. (STZ) operates in the Consumer Non-Durables sector, specifically in the Beverages: Alcoholic industry. The company has a market capitalization of $45.19 billion.
